Environmental Fate Studies on Certain Munition Wastewater Constituents. Part I. Model Validation

Abstract

The objective of this report was to validate the SRI Computer Model for estimating the persistence of TNT and RDX (emanating from the Holston Army Ammunition Plant (HAAP) wastestreams) in the Holston River. A two-dimensional compartmentalized river system was developed that describes the dilution of wastestreams entering the Holston River from which the concentrations of RDX and TNT can be estimated. Rate and equilibrium constants for the environmental transport and transformation processes affecting the persistence of TNT and RDX were incorporated into the model and concentration-distance pollutant profiles were simulated. Field study data validated the model for RDX, however, sufficient field data could not be obtained to validate the model for TNT.
